Is Your Oracle EBS Ready for DevSecOps?

Flexagon

Upgrades bring faster services and new features, increasing the need to introduce innovation earlier in the development process. With DevSecOps, you take a “shift-left” approach to testing and automation, which moves testing, quality, and performance evaluation earlier in the development life cycle.

The Hacker Mind Podcast: Fuzzing Hyper-V

ForAllSecure

Ophir Harpaz and Peleg Hadar join The Hacker Mind to discuss their journey from designing a custom fuzzer to identifying a critical vulnerability within Hyper-V and how their new research tool, hAFL1, can benefit others looking to secure other cloud architectures.
